I've noticed when I go to the list of retired players, all the stats are 0 at first no matter what type of player I select (so the problem isn't that I'm looking at a list of pitchers while the stats are on 'batter 1' or vice versa).
If I click on a player, it brings up their profile page, where it shows their career stats. When I click back to the retired player list, it's suddenly filled in with all the stats. So I've just gotten into the habit of pulling the list, clicking a player and going back. |
